Zé do Rock
Summary
Zé do Rock is a human[1]. He was born in Porto Alegre[2]. He was born on June 3, 1956[3]. He worked as a writer[4].
Key Facts
- Zé do Rock was born in Porto Alegre[2].
- Zé do Rock was born on June 3, 1956[3].
- Zé do Rock held citizenship in Brazil[5].
- Zé do Rock worked as a writer[4].
- Zé do Rock received the Ernst Hoferichter award[6].
- Zé do Rock received the Märkisch Scholarship for Literature[7].
- Zé do Rock received the Schwabing Art Prize[8].
- Zé do Rock was a member of PEN Germany[9].
- Zé do Rock was a member of Verein Deutsche Sprache[10].
- Zé do Rock is recorded as male[11].
- Zé do Rock's instance of is recorded as human[12].
- Zé do Rock's given name is recorded as Zé[13].
- Zé do Rock's work location is recorded as Munich[14].
- Zé do Rock's languages spoken, written or signed is recorded as Portuguese[15].
